### Changed defaults — Graphwright 4.2

The dependency graph visualizer now collapses transitive edges by default, which dramatically reduces render time on large monorepos but hides indirect cycles. Maintainers who relied on full expansion must opt back in explicitly. To make audits reproducible, the new shipped defaults are recorded here in full.

service settings:
novath:
  pin: 1396
  tenant: pelys
  seal: seal_ccc035e1
  metrics_host: metrics.novath.qorvelworks.test
  standby_team: fraeth
  escalation: drueth-zorok
  nonce: 61d508

## Configuration: Broker Upgrade (Relaybus 5.x)

For the release manager: upgrading Pipewright's message broker from Relaybus 4.x to 5.x requires a config migration before the first 5.x node starts. Run `pipewright migrate-broker` against the staging cluster, confirm consumer offsets survive, then schedule the rolling restart. The 5.x nodes require authenticated inter-node traffic, which 4.x did not. Before starting any 5.x node, the env file must include the following line:

sealed setting: ARCHIVE_KEY3=8d0

### Runbook — ScanBridge barcode intake (Ostermill warehouse)

If scanners stop posting to ScanBridge, first confirm the relay service is up and the device firmware matches 3.4+. Then verify the intake env file on the relay host: `SCANBRIDGE_ENDPOINT` must point at the regional collector, and `RETRY_WINDOW_SECONDS` should stay at 30. The relay authenticates every batch with a shared credential, which is set on the following line.

env line for fafof-fahag: LEDGER_TOKEN5=f8790